oidc groups: store and expose the OIDC groups claim
Add a Groups column on the User model populated from the OIDC 'groups' claim at login, and surface it through the gRPC/REST User message so external tools (Headplane) can read group membership without reaching into the database. - proto: add 'repeated string groups = 9' to v1.User. - types.User: Groups text column, GetGroups/SetGroups JSON helpers, FromClaim populates from claims.Groups. The existing FlexibleStringSlice on OIDCClaims.Groups already handles JumpCloud-style single-string emission. - types.User.Proto(): populate v1.User.Groups via GetGroups(). - db migration 202505141323: add the column BEFORE the existing 202505141324 migration that loads users via the struct, so the schema is in place before any migration touches the User type. - db migration 202507021200: extend the inline CREATE TABLE users and INSERT INTO users ... SELECT FROM users_old to carry the new column through the SQLite schema-recreation step. - schema.sql: declare the column so squibble.Validate accepts databases produced by the new migration chain. Verified against all 7 historical sqlite dumps in hscontrol/db/testdata/sqlite. - types.UserView, types_clone.go: regenerated to expose Groups. - config-example.yaml, docs/ref/oidc.md: note the 'groups' scope and the role the column plays for external integrations. - integration/oidc_groups_test.go: verify the round-trip via headscale.ListUsers() for users with multi-group, single-group, and empty group memberships.
